如何共享服务器的计算能力

不及物动词 其他 29

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    共享服务器的计算能力可以通过以下几种方式实现:

    1. 虚拟化技术:虚拟化技术可以将一台物理服务器分割成多个虚拟机,每个虚拟机具有独立的计算能力和资源。通过虚拟化技术,可以将服务器的计算能力共享给多个用户或应用程序,提高服务器资源的利用率。

    2. 容器化技术:容器化技术可以将应用程序及其依赖打包成独立的容器,在同一台服务器上运行多个容器,并且每个容器之间相互隔离。通过容器化技术,可以更加灵活地共享服务器的计算能力,并且提供更好的资源隔离和管理。

    3. 负载均衡:使用负载均衡技术可以将请求均匀地分发给多台服务器,实现对计算能力的共享。负载均衡可以通过多种方式实现,例如基于硬件的负载均衡器、软件定义的网络(SDN)、云平台等。

    4. 分布式计算:分布式计算是一种将计算任务分发到多个服务器上同时进行计算的方式。通过分布式计算,可以将大规模的计算任务分解成多个小任务,并且利用多台服务器的计算能力并行地进行计算,提高计算效率。

    综上所述,共享服务器的计算能力可以通过虚拟化技术、容器化技术、负载均衡和分布式计算等方法实现。这些方法可以提高服务器的资源利用率,拓展计算能力,并且提供更好的性能和可扩展性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    共享服务器的计算能力是一种常见的实践,旨在充分利用服务器资源,提高系统的性能和效率。以下是一些共享服务器计算能力的方法:

    1. 虚拟化技术:通过使用虚拟化软件,可以将一台物理服务器划分为多个虚拟服务器,每个虚拟服务器都可以独立运行自己的操作系统和应用程序。这样可以充分利用服务器的计算能力,提高资源利用率。

    2. 负载均衡:负载均衡是一种将多台服务器上承载的工作负载均匀分配的技术。通过使用负载均衡器,可以将请求均匀地分发到不同的服务器上,从而实现服务器计算能力的共享。负载均衡还可以提高系统的可靠性和容错性。

    3. 分布式计算:分布式计算是一种利用多台服务器共同完成计算任务的方法。通过将任务分解为多个子任务,并在多个服务器上并行处理,可以充分利用服务器的计算能力,加快计算速度。分布式计算还可以提高系统的可扩展性和弹性。

    4. 云计算平台:云计算平台提供了一种将服务器计算能力共享给多个用户的方式。用户可以通过云计算平台租用服务器资源,并按需分配计算能力。云计算平台还提供了弹性扩展和资源调度的功能,可以根据实际需求动态调整计算资源。

    5. 容器化技术:容器化技术是一种将应用程序及其依赖项打包成可移植的容器的方法。通过使用容器化技术,可以将应用程序在不同的服务器上部署和运行,实现服务器计算能力的共享。容器化技术还可以提高应用程序的可移植性和灵活性。

    总之,共享服务器的计算能力可以通过虚拟化技术、负载均衡、分布式计算、云计算平台和容器化技术等方法实现。这些方法可以提高服务器的利用率、加快计算速度,并提供弹性扩展和资源调度的功能。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    共享服务器的计算能力可以通过以下几种方式实现:

    1. 虚拟化技术:利用虚拟化技术,将物理服务器划分为多个虚拟服务器,每个虚拟服务器独立运行,可以分配给不同的用户使用。常见的虚拟化技术有VMware、KVM、Xen等。通过虚拟化技术,可以最大限度地利用服务器的计算资源,提高整体计算能力。

    2. 容器化技术:容器化技术是一种轻量级的虚拟化技术,通过容器引擎将应用程序与其运行环境进行隔离。相比传统虚拟化技术,容器化技术更加高效,可以在同一物理服务器上运行更多的容器实例。常见的容器化平台有Docker、Kubernetes等。

    3. 负载均衡:通过负载均衡技术,可以将来自多个用户的请求分发到多台服务器上进行处理,实现服务器计算能力的共享。负载均衡可以根据服务器的负载情况自动调整请求的分发策略,有效地提高系统的可用性和性能。

    4. 分布式计算:将任务分解为多个子任务,分发到不同的服务器上进行处理,最后将结果合并。分布式计算可以充分利用多台服务器的计算能力,加快任务的处理速度。常见的分布式计算框架有Hadoop、Spark等。

    5. 边缘计算:边缘计算是一种将计算能力移近用户的计算模式,通过在离用户较近的服务器上进行数据处理和计算,提供更低的延迟和更高的吞吐量。边缘计算可以将计算任务分布到多台边缘节点上进行处理,实现计算能力的共享。

    具体操作流程如下:

    1. 配置虚拟化环境:安装虚拟化软件(如VMware、KVM等),创建虚拟机并分配计算资源。根据实际需求将物理服务器划分为多个虚拟服务器,并为每个虚拟服务器配置适当的计算资源,如CPU、内存、存储等。

    2. 配置容器化环境:安装容器引擎(如Docker),创建容器并分配计算资源。将应用程序与其运行环境打包成容器镜像,通过容器引擎运行多个容器实例。可以根据需要对容器进行资源限制和分配。

    3. 配置负载均衡:选择适当的负载均衡解决方案(如Nginx、HAProxy等),配置负载均衡规则。将多台服务器连接到负载均衡设备上,并配置请求的分发策略(如轮询、最小连接数等),以实现计算能力的共享。

    4. 配置分布式计算框架:安装分布式计算框架(如Hadoop、Spark),配置集群环境。将任务分解为多个子任务,并分发到集群中的多台服务器上进行处理,最后将结果合并。可以根据实际需求对集群进行扩展,增加计算能力。

    5. 配置边缘计算环境:选择适当的边缘计算平台,部署边缘节点。将计算任务分发到边缘节点上进行处理,提高计算效率。可以根据实际需求配置多个边缘节点,并利用边缘节点之间的通信进行任务协同和数据传输。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部